### Step 4: Cut over the autoscaler

QueuePilot now reads depth metrics from the new ledger table instead of the legacy gauge. Stop the old poller, apply migration 0042, then restart the scaler workers. Verify scale events land in `scaler_audit` within two minutes. The workers read their state store via the connection below:

replica DSN, kajep-yahag: mssql://praok_svc:iF@db-8d68.plorvaio.local:5432/eliion

Subject: Handover — FormulaCell sandbox DB

Taking over FormulaCell sandboxing from me as of Monday. User-supplied formulas run in the Quillbox interpreter with no filesystem or network access; results land in an isolated schema. Audit logs retain thirty days. Review the grants on the sandbox role first. For your review, the sandbox database connection string is below.

warehouse DSN: clickhouse://druys_svc:Pl@db-47e1.orvexstack.corp:5432/beldor

Every plugin submitted to the Quillcheck marketplace is scanned against our static-analysis baseline, stored as `baseline.qcheck` in the repo root. The baseline suppresses known, accepted findings so your CI runs stay green; new findings will fail the gate. Do not edit the baseline by hand — regenerate it with `qcheck baseline --refresh` and include the diff in your pull request. If the gate flags something you believe is a false positive, the Analyzer Tooling team at Fernhollow Systems reviews exemption requests.

escalation mailbox, hadug-bajog: sormir@norvalabs.internal

Heads up for reviewers: the nightly inventory reconciliation job (StockMender) pulls counts from the Larkspur warehouse feed and diffs them against what Ledgerbird thinks we have. If the drift exceeds 2%, it opens a discrepancy report instead of auto-correcting — that's intentional, don't "fix" it. The job runs in the recon-worker pod and retries three times with backoff before paging anyone. To replay a failed run locally, point it at the staging Ledgerbird endpoint and authenticate with the key below.

app token of bahaf-tajeg = zpat23_SjjsllwiLmXbtS65veZaV47